VIDEO Stenciling on Kraft Card Stock featuring the Ice Cream Cone Stencil

Hi there, all!  It's Tara and I hope you're having a fabulous week!  For some reason I feel like it should be Friday today . . . this week is just dragging for me!  But I am glad to hear that it is, in fact, Thursday because that means I have another amazing Mint Owl Studio video for you!!  Check out the fabulous background I created using the Ice Cream Cone stencil!  I also used the Happy Moments and Birthday Bash stamp sets to complete this fun one-layer card. 


For today's project I am using a technique that I picked up from Kristina Werner ages ago when I was just a little stamping baby - stenciling over white pigment ink on kraft card stock.  This is one of those techniques we all love to have in our toolbox because it is super simple but packs a big punch!


I added some masking using my MISTI tool to up the ante with a one-layer card that looks 3D but this stenciling technique could easily be the focal point of your card since it is just so pretty!  All you need to do is stencil first in white pigment ink, then pick up your stencil and shift it ever so slightly in whichever direction you want (I went up and slightly to the right) and then stencil over the white in your colored dye ink.  The white underneath allows the colored ink to really pop and the shift of the stencil provides a fabulous white shadow on one side and dark shadow on the other!  Really fun to play with!

Hello Friend

Good morning, everyone! It's Cassie here, with another fun card using some of the new products from the August release. I'm so excited about this card. Do you ever have an idea for a project that turns out exactly how you hoped? That's how I felt about this card!

Let's take a look at the card!
This card showcases the Birthday Bash and the Banner Sentiments  stamp set. I think these two sets combined are amazing together. As you can see I made a fun scene of balloons using the solid balloon image in Birthday Bash and added the sentiments as if they were printed on the balloons themselves.
I started by grabbing a rainbow of Distress Inks. I picked two colors per balloon. To get them fade from one color the next was a lot easier than it may seem! I pressed the balloon stamp into the first color like you normally would except that I only inked up the left side of the balloon. Then I took the second color and did the same on the right side. I let the colors over lap a little, but it didn't matter if they did too much because of the next step. Once I had one balloon stamped I took a damp brush and mixed the colors on the balloon with water. It helps get rid of any harsh lines and makes the colors blend a bit more. The great thing about this look is that it isn't supposed to be perfect. Imperfections make it cute, so embrace them! 
When the balloons were completely dry I picked some sentiments that fit in the balloon and stamped them in black ink. I added strings to them using a black Copic liner and a T-square ruler. Personally I love the look of completely straight lines here, but you could go crazy and give them curly ribbon too! I added some stitched detail, which you can see better in the picture above, and some black splatters, as well as a black cardstock panel to be put behind the balloon panel. Once that was cone the card was finished!

Thursday, August 25, 2016

Emboss Resist Background featuring Birthday Bash

Hello and happy Thursday!  It's Tara and for today's project I am using the brand new Birthday Bash and Party Pals stamp sets from the August release!  These sets go together so well and I thought it would be fun to combine them, along with the Happy Moments sentiment set, to make a birthday card for my sweet niece!


I just love the scattering of stars image that is in the Birthday Bash set so I decided to heat emboss it all over a piece of Distress watercolor cardstock using some clear glittery embossing powder.  Then, using Distress Inks, I was able to add color over the clear embossing and leave behind a bright and cheerful starry background! And it's glittery!  


I colored the little girl from the Party Pals set using my Zig Clean Color Real Brush markers and fussy cut her out.  Next, I used white embossing powder to heat emboss my sentiment - the big scripty happy from the Happy Moments set and the birthday from the Party Pals set.


Once all of my elements were on the card I added a few sequins and some Spectrum Noir clear sparkle pen and this card is all done!  So much fun to create!

Bunch of Birthday Wishes

Hi everyone! It's Cassie here, and I'll be showing you a fun card I made using some of the newly released stamps from this month! I used Birthday Bash stamp set as well as the Packaged Pretty dies. From an older release I also used the Ice Cream Cone stencil. Let's take a look at the card!


I started this card by cutting a panel down to 4 1/4 x 5 1/2. Then I took the square die from Packaged Pretty and placed it where I wanted my cuts to be. I also cut a square out of some aqua paper that went with my color scheme. I stamped the balloons on one of the squares and colored them in using my Copics. Then I stamped the sentiment on the aqua square.
Before I put the whole thing together I placed my stencil over the panel and used some Distress Ink and an ink blended to give the background a pattern. I used two colors, and shifted the stencil slightly when doing the second color so both colors could be seen. Once that was done I put all the pieces together like a puzzle on a card base.

Once I added some glossy accents to the balloons the card was finished! I love how bright this card is. The balloons are so fun because they can be colored to match any card or theme!

A Birthday Layout with New Stamps!

Hello amazing crafting friends!  It is Lisa here today and I'm going to share a layout I've made with the new stamps!  By the way did you join us for our blog hop?  Make sure you hop through and leave comments on yesterdays post for a chance to win all of the new release! Now, onto todays post...




To create this layout I started with the stars stamp from the Birthday Bash Stamp Set on the background going at a diagonal.  I then used  yellow and orange distress inks over the Half Tone Stencil at the bottom corner and on the opposite upper corner.  I then layered this with a red and blue mist.  This was set off to dry and I began stamping strips of designs on a separate white card stock.  I used the Birthday Bash Stamp Set again for the balloon image, bows and sentiments.  To get the look of designer paper I used various colored inks and randomly stamped them in rows across the card stock.  Next I diecut tag shapes out of these rows and layered them down the side next to the photos.  I then stamped the banner and balloons from this set, colored them in with Copic Markers, trimmed and adhered them to the layout.  ( I really LOVE this balloon image!)  Throw on a couple of stickers, dots and sequins and you've got yourself a Birthday Layout!
